{"id":248605,"date":"2025-08-29T12:33:47","date_gmt":"2025-08-29T12:33:47","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/embed-anything-for-elementor\/"},"modified":"2025-08-29T12:39:50","modified_gmt":"2025-08-29T12:39:50","slug":"embed-anything-elementor","status":"publish","type":"plugin","link":"https:\/\/ve.wordpress.org\/plugins\/embed-anything-elementor\/","author":14261152,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_crdt_document":"","version":"1.0.0","stable_tag":"1.0.0","tested":"6.8.5","requires":"6.0","requires_php":"8.0","requires_plugins":null,"header_name":"Embed Anything for Elementor","header_author":"WpErrorFix.com","header_description":"A powerful Elementor widget for embedding iframes with support for videos, maps, PDFs, and more. SEO-optimized and mobile-friendly.","assets_banners_color":"33469d","last_updated":"2025-08-29 12:39:50","external_support_url":"","external_repository_url":"","donate_link":"","header_plugin_uri":"","header_author_uri":"https:\/\/wperrorfix.com\/","rating":0,"author_block_rating":0,"active_installs":10,"downloads":335,"num_ratings":0,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":{"1.0.0":{"tag":"1.0.0","author":"Sshahadatgsm","date":"2025-08-29 12:39:50"}},"upgrade_notice":{"1.0.0":"<p>Initial release. No upgrades available yet.<\/p>"},"ratings":[],"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":3353076,"resolution":"128x128","location":"assets","locale":""}},"assets_banners":{"banner-772x250.png":{"filename":"banner-772x250.png","revision":3352754,"resolution":"772x250","location":"assets","locale":""}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":["1.0.0"],"block_files":[],"assets_screenshots":{"screenshot-1.png":{"filename":"screenshot-1.png","revision":3352754,"resolution":"1","location":"assets","locale":""},"screenshot-2.png":{"filename":"screenshot-2.png","revision":3352754,"resolution":"2","location":"assets","locale":""},"screenshot-3.png":{"filename":"screenshot-3.png","revision":3352754,"resolution":"3","location":"assets","locale":""}},"screenshots":{"1":"Widget settings panel in Elementor.","2":"Responsive height adjustment in preview mode.","3":"Lazy load, Custom ID &amp; Custom Attributes"},"jetpack_post_was_ever_published":false},"plugin_section":[],"plugin_tags":[247062,247060,230,247063,247061],"plugin_category":[56],"plugin_contributors":[232716],"plugin_business_model":[],"class_list":["post-248605","plugin","type-plugin","status-publish","hentry","plugin_tags-custom-iframe","plugin_tags-elementor-iframe","plugin_tags-embed","plugin_tags-embed-anything-to-elementor","plugin_tags-iframe-for-elementor","plugin_category-social-and-sharing","plugin_contributors-sshahadatgsm","plugin_committers-sshahadatgsm"],"banners":{"banner":"https:\/\/ps.w.org\/embed-anything-elementor\/assets\/banner-772x250.png?rev=3352754","banner_2x":false,"ban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/embed-anything-elementor\/assets\/icon-128x128.png?rev=3353076","icon_2x":false,"generated":false},"screenshots":[{"src":"https:\/\/ps.w.org\/embed-anything-elementor\/assets\/screenshot-1.png?rev=3352754","caption":"Widget settings panel in Elementor."},{"src":"https:\/\/ps.w.org\/embed-anything-elementor\/assets\/screenshot-2.png?rev=3352754","caption":"Responsive height adjustment in preview mode."},{"src":"https:\/\/ps.w.org\/embed-anything-elementor\/assets\/screenshot-3.png?rev=3352754","caption":"Lazy load, Custom ID &amp; Custom Attributes"}],"raw_content":"<!--section=description-->\n<p>Embed Anything for Elementor adds iframes with responsive height, lazy loading, custom IDs, and auto-refresh. Perfect for videos, maps, PDFs.<\/p>\n\n<h3>Key Features<\/h3>\n\n<ul>\n<li><strong>Responsive Design<\/strong>: Adjust iframe height for desktop, tablet, and mobile views.<\/li>\n<li><strong>Auto Height<\/strong>: Dynamically adjust iframe height based on content (cross-domain support via postMessage).<\/li>\n<li><strong>Lazy Loading<\/strong>: Improve page speed with optional lazy loading.<\/li>\n<li><strong>Auto-Refresh<\/strong>: Set intervals to refresh iframes automatically.<\/li>\n<li><strong>Customizable<\/strong>: Add custom IDs and attributes for advanced styling.<\/li>\n<li><strong>Scrollbars Control<\/strong>: Enable or disable scrollbars as needed.<\/li>\n<\/ul>\n\n<p>Ideal for developers and designers looking to integrate external content without compromising site performance or design integrity.<\/p>\n\n<h3>External Services<\/h3>\n\n<p>This plugin uses the Google Docs Viewer service to embed documents (e.g., PDFs, Word documents) within Elementor widgets for display on your website.<\/p>\n\n<ul>\n<li><strong>Service Purpose<\/strong>: The Google Docs Viewer service is used to generate an embedded view of documents by sending the document URL to Google's servers.<\/li>\n<li><strong>Data Sent<\/strong>: The plugin sends the URL of the document to be embedded each time the widget is loaded on a page. No additional user data is sent unless specified by the website configuration.<\/li>\n<li><strong>Service Provider<\/strong>: Google Docs Viewer, provided by Google.<\/li>\n<li><strong>Terms of Service<\/strong>: https:\/\/policies.google.com\/terms<\/li>\n<li><strong>Privacy Policy<\/strong>: https:\/\/policies.google.com\/privacy<\/li>\n<\/ul>\n\n<h3>Additional Notes<\/h3>\n\n<h3>Support<\/h3>\n\n<p>For assistance, visit our support forum or contact us on our <a href=\"https:\/\/wperrorfix.com\/contact\/\">WpErrorFix site<\/a>.<\/p>\n\n<p>This plugin is optimized for SEO and performance, ensuring your embedded content ranks well and loads efficiently.<\/p>\n\n<!--section=installation-->\n<ol>\n<li>Install the plugin via the WordPress plugin directory or upload the <code>embed-anything-elementor<\/code> folder to the <code>\/wp-content\/plugins\/<\/code> directory.<\/li>\n<li>Activate the plugin through the 'Plugins' menu in WordPress.<\/li>\n<li>Open an Elementor page or create a new one.<\/li>\n<li>Add the \"Embed Anything Iframe\" widget from the Elementor editor.<\/li>\n<li>Configure the widget settings (e.g., source URL, height, auto height) and publish your page.<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id='does%20this%20plugin%20work%20with%20all%20elementor%20versions%3F'><h3>Does this plugin work with all Elementor versions?<\/h3><\/dt>\n<dd><p>Yes, it is compatible with Elementor 3.0 and above, tested up to version 3.31.2.<\/p><\/dd>\n<dt id='can%20i%20embed%20cross-domain%20content%3F'><h3>Can I embed cross-domain content?<\/h3><\/dt>\n<dd><p>Yes, but for auto height to work with cross-domain iframes, the embedded page must support height communication via postMessage.<\/p><\/dd>\n<dt id='why%20isn%E2%80%99t%20the%20auto-refresh%20working%3F'><h3>Why isn\u2019t the auto-refresh working?<\/h3><\/dt>\n<dd><p>Ensure the refresh interval is set to a positive value (e.g., 15 seconds). Cross-origin restrictions might require a fallback reload method, which is handled by the plugin.<\/p><\/dd>\n<dt id='how%20do%20i%20troubleshoot%20issues%3F'><h3>How do I troubleshoot issues?<\/h3><\/dt>\n<dd><p>Enable WP_DEBUG in <code>wp-config.php<\/code> and check <code>wp-content\/debug.log<\/code> for errors. Contact support if needed.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.0.0<\/h4>\n\n<ul>\n<li>Initial release with core features: responsive height, auto height, lazy load, scrollbars, and auto-refresh.<\/li>\n<\/ul>","raw_excerpt":"Embed responsive iframes easily with Embed Anything Iframe for Elementor. Customize your WordPress site with flexible iframe options.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/248605","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=248605"}],"author":[{"emb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/sshahadatgsm"}],"wp:attachment":[{"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=248605"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=248605"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=248605"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=248605"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=248605"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/ve.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=248605"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}